Many thanks for your letter of 29th April and I am glad that you found the poem by Ai Qing on "Hong Kong" of interest.
My talk at the Foreign Correspondents Club here on Tuesday, 12th May on the topic "Hong Kong Now and Forever" giving a few purely personal views was ex- tremely well received. In fact the Club President told me there had never been a bigger luncheon crowd. This perhaps was an indication of the concern the whole community here feels over an issue which has far-reaching effects all around.
I believe you might like to have a copy of the talk and this I am pleased to enclose.
